Chiglitazar Preferentially Regulates Gene Expression via Configuration-Restricted Binding and Phosphorylation Inhibition of PPARγ

Figure 5

Increased ANGPTL4 and PDK4 expressions are associated with inhibition of TNFα-induced and CDK5-mediated phosphorylation of PPARγ. HPA-v cells were incubated with different protein kinases (i.e., VEGFR and PDGFR inhibitor Sutent (1 μM), AURK A/B/C inhibitor VX680 (0.1 μM), MEK1/2 inhibitor U0126 (1 μM), and CDK5 inhibitor roscovitine (Rosc, 10 μM) or vehicle control (0.1% (vol/vol) DMSO) in the presence of TNFα (5 ng/ml) for 24 hours. Total RNA was extracted and subjected to real-time RT-PCR as described in Materials and Methods. Data represent the average and standard deviation of three independent experiments. represents statistically significant differences in expression induction by roscovitine compared to all other inhibitors ().
